Dunleavy’s parental rights bill gets no love from LGBT Alaskans or teachers during committee hearing

During the first House Education Committee hearing for House Bill 105, the governor’s Parental Rights Act, there was a long line of people testifying — and nine out of 10 of them opposed the bill. The phone lines were packed, with 154 calling in, and 125 getting through to testify.
